From b8b7b75ad03cdbb742e12dece6b60a17fe9dc0a2 Mon Sep 17 00:00:00 2001
From: Rhys Arkins <rhys@arkins.net>
Date: Wed, 12 Feb 2020 13:17:35 +0100
Subject: [PATCH] fix(npm): await 5s before ECONNRESET retry

---
 lib/datasource/npm/get.ts | 1 +
 1 file changed, 1 insertion(+)

diff --git a/lib/datasource/npm/get.ts b/lib/datasource/npm/get.ts
index 2952f79f5f..c37610dd39 100644
--- a/lib/datasource/npm/get.ts
+++ b/lib/datasource/npm/get.ts
@@ -231,6 +231,7 @@ export async function getDependency(
       // istanbul ignore if
       if (err.code === 'ECONNRESET' && retries > 1) {
         logger.info({ regUrl }, 'Retrying npm ECONNRESET');
+        await delay(5000);
         return getDependency(name, retries - 1);
       }
       logger.warn(
-- 
GitLab